# Context for reviewer: Pondwire clients were dropping websocket connections every ~90s
# behind the Graymoor proxy. Root cause: reconnect handshake reused a stale nonce,
# so the Tidewell broker rejected resumption and forced a cold start. Fix requires
# a dedicated resume token per environment instead of deriving one from the session
# key. Heartbeat interval stays at 30s; backoff unchanged. Staging verified by the
# Fennick team over a 6h soak, zero drops. The token is set on the next line.

sealed setting: ARCHIVE_KEY3=8d0

**Q: How do soft deletes work in the Marrowgate orders table?**

Rows are never hard-deleted. A deleted_at timestamp marks removal; plugins must filter on it or use the provided scope. Purges run nightly after 90 days. Do not write raw DELETE statements — the audit trigger will reject them. To restore a purged partition from the Thornquay archive, you need vault access, which is granted via the recovery phrase below.

unlock words, yaguf-fajep: praiel-kasdor-druax-wenix-fenok-juldor-eliox-zordor-novath-quenir

Q: What changed in the Tindermere password reset revamp? A: We replaced the old email-link flow with a token-plus-verification-code flow, shipped last sprint by the Accounts pod. Reset links now expire in 15 minutes, and failed attempts are throttled per device. Support tooling in the Opsboard was updated to match, so manual resets are rarely needed. If you must perform a manual reset during the sync demo, you'll be prompted for the team recovery passphrase, which is below.

unlock words, yawig-kagef: gordor-holvan-ulaael-pramir-ulaiel-tamdor

Handover: Gridlark export service. Spreadsheet exports over ~200k rows balloon heap usage because the whole workbook is built in memory before streaming. I added a row-batched writer behind the `stream_xlsx` flag; it cuts peak RSS roughly 70% but cell merges aren't supported yet. Leave the flag off for the Tallowmere tenant until merges land. Memory alerts fire at 6GB — if they recur, check the template cache first, it leaks under concurrent exports. Questions on the batching code go to the maintainer named below.

named custodian: Oliath Ralax